I just bought Pianoteq - and here's why.
I have several piano programs, including a few from Native Instruments.
BUT, Native Instruments has lately reduced the customizability of its products. For example, in Kontakt 6 and prior versions, I could modify a great many of the parameters on its instruments (using the "wrench" icon/button). In Kontakt 7, the ability to do this was removed.
The main thing I liked to modify was the ADSR - most especially and almost exclusively is the Release. I can't do that anymore with Kontakt 7 and above.
So, I downloaded the Pianoteq trial version - and voila - I could alter the sustain pedal, making the sustain shorter or longer as I desired! This was almost exactly what I had been modifying in my Native Instruments. And, there were other parameters I could modify to suit the moods I wanted from the piano, especially in the release/sustain portions of the sounds.
That - along with the quality piano sounds - sold me, and I am a happy purchaser!
